Breakfast was better than most continentals. Only complaint is that the pancake batter in the auto pancake machine was empty and the person working the breakfast area was unaware bc she was chatting with the desk clerk. A-
The indoor pool was clean and the water was numbingly cold for June in Texas. A++
Bed linens were clean and appeared like new. The bathroom grout around the shower was looking like it could’ve used a re-do. Some crumbling and mold seen around bathroom floor/walk edges. A-
The desk clerk at this hotel needs further training. I’m staying with my 4 yr old niece who closed the door after I had stepped around the corner on my floor (3) to get ice. The desk clerk wanted me to show my ID to make me another key to get back in the room where my ID was located so how could I provide my ID? That’s an unrealistic question to ask. I asked her if she wanted my DL # to prove who I was? Verify DOB, address, something else besides ID? She proceeded to tell me about “in the future we will need to see your ID to provide a room key”. She asked for my room # again after I’d already provided it. I came down to the desk from the elevator not the front door. We checked in yesterday, not today. I think answering other questions would be more appropriate and realistic than asking for ID that is already on file. She was very curt and rude as well as unrealistic. Contacted IHG chat. No response re: issue 3 days later. D
There is a large homeless/vagrant presence in and around the parking lot. A person was sitting in front of my car on the curb at the front of the hotel. The area is very close to I-30. I never saw any type of security in the lobby or parking lot. F
I will not stay here again. The parking lot is unsafe. The desk clerks are not friendly and treat you like you’re staying there for free.
